You have met them, haven't you?. The autodidacts, the half-educated, spouting their banalities and most of the time with a quite terrifying confidence. They have a half-baked opinion on everything and all issued with an overriding certainty sans the humility of doubt. You listen to them, secretly wishing there was some kind of restraining order in the ether, something to at least make them pause. If you want some comfort from this half baked onslaught read: Bouvard and Pécuchet, Flaubert’s satire on the indiscriminate accumulation of half-digested knowledge.
